4. Time Mode — When this mode is selected, the SECONDS LED lights to indicate that the value displayed or to be entered represents seconds. Enter the exposure time desired to a maximum of 9,999 seconds (2 hours, 46 minutes and 39 seconds). The minimum value that can be entered is one second.
TESTING AND SCREENING RecA The Spectrolinker can be used for testing and screening RecA mutation which can prevent repair of UV-induced damage on cells, thereby retarding their growth [6]. UV STERILIZATION When the Spectrolinker is equipped with short wave (254nm) tubes, various sterilization processes can be undertaken for laboratory purposes [7,8,9].
